92/100 reduced to a fraction in lowest form

OpenStudy (anonymous):

23/25

OpenStudy (anonymous):

Do you need help learning how? Do you know how to make a factorial tree of both numbers? Then you can cancel out the common factors, and add up what's left in the N and the D (as in N/D). Another way is to find the biggest number that will divide into both, and divide it out of both. Then try again to see if you can do it again. When you run out, you're done!
